Deck Building Cost Breakdown in Pittsburg, KS

Project TypeLowTypicalHigh
Pressure-Treated Wood Deck$3,400$5,950$9,350
Composite Deck (Trex, TimberTech)$6,800$12,750$21,250
Cedar Deck$5,100$8,500$13,600
Deck Railing Addition$850$2,125$4,250
Deck Staining/Sealing$425$850$1,700
Deck Repair$215$640$1,700

Prices adjusted for Pittsburg, KS cost of living. Actual costs may vary. Get multiple quotes for accurate pricing.

Factors That Affect Deck Building Cost in Pittsburg

  • Deck size (square footage)
  • Material (pressure-treated, cedar, composite)
  • Deck height and complexity
  • Railing style and material
  • Built-in features (stairs, benches, planters)
  • Permit requirements
  • Site prep and grading

How much does a deck cost per square foot?

Pressure-treated wood decks cost $15 to $30 per square foot. Composite decks cost $25 to $50 per square foot. Cedar falls between at $20 to $40 per square foot.

How long does it take to build a deck?

A simple deck takes 1 to 2 weeks. A multi-level or complex deck with built-in features can take 3 to 4 weeks. Permit approval adds time to the overall timeline.

Do I need a permit to build a deck?

Almost always yes. Most jurisdictions require a building permit for new decks, especially if attached to the house or elevated above ground level.
